Vapor-liquid equilibrium data for the binary system isooctane-perfluoroheptane at 303, 323, and 343 k are available (see excel workbook). the vapor phase in equilibrium with the liquid may be considered an ideal-gas mixture. specific volumes of liquids are negligible compared to vapor specific volumes. the enthalpies of vaporization of pure isooctane and perfluoroheptane at 323 k are 34.33 and 35.31 kj/mol, respectively.
a) a saturated liquid stream containing 50 mole% isooctane is flowing in a pipeline at 323 k. what is the minimum isothermal, isobaric work required to separate this stream into two liquid fractions that contain 90 and 5 mole% isooctane, respectively? diagram your proposed process scheme.
b) a batch vessel at 323 k contains 100 moles of liquid with 50 mole% isooctane. devise a scheme to boil this liquid in such a manner that the pressure remains constant at the original value; the temperature is also to remain constant at 323 k. calculate the heat interaction for the process ending with only vapor in the vessel.
